Работа с данными из Excel в документах Word — стандартная задача для аналитиков, бухгалтеров и менеджеров, которым нужно сочетать текстовые отчёты с динамическими таблицами. Но простое копирование через Ctrl+C → Ctrl+V часто приводит к потере форматирования, формул и возможности автоматически обновлять данные. В этой статье разберём все актуальные способы вставки — от статической картинки до полноценной привязки с синхронизацией.
Особенность процесса в том, что Microsoft Word не поддерживает прямую вставку файлов .xlsx/.xls как объектов OLE в версиях новее 2019 года без дополнительных настроек. Это означает, что для корректной работы придётся использовать обходные пути или специальные параметры вставки. Мы протестировали все методы на Office 2016, 2019, 2021 и Microsoft 365 — и готовы предоставить работающие решения даже для сложных случаев (например, таблиц с сводными данными или Power Query).
1. Способы вставки Excel в Word: сравнение методов
Прежде чем переходить к инструкциям, важно понять, какой результат вам нужен. Все методы делятся на 3 категории:
- 📎 Статическая вставка — таблица становится частью документа Word (не обновляется, формулы превращаются в значения). Подходит для фиксированных отчётов.
- 🔄 Динамическая привязка — данные синхронизируются с исходным файлом Excel (обновляются при изменении источника). Необходимо для живых документов.
- 🖼️ Вставка как объект/картинка — таблица отображается как изображение или встроенный элемент (можно редактировать двойным кликом, но ограниченно).
Выбор метода зависит от того, планируете ли вы:
- ✅ Обновлять данные в Word при изменении Excel
- ✅ Сохранять возможность редактировать формулы прямо в Word
- ✅ Печатать документ с высоким качеством (без разбивки таблиц)
- ✅ Использовать документ на устройствах без Excel (например, на телефоне)
| Метод | Сохраняются формулы? | Автообновление | Редактирование в Word | Качество печати | Подходит для больших таблиц |
|---|---|---|---|---|---|
Копирование как картинка (Скопировать как рисунок) |
❌ Нет | ❌ Нет | ❌ Нет | ⚠️ Среднее (размытие при масштабировании) | ✅ Да |
Специальная вставка → Лист Microsoft Excel |
✅ Да | ✅ Да (при сохранении привязки) | ✅ Да (двойной клик) | ✅ Высокое | ⚠️ Ограничено (до 1000 строк) |
Вставка как связанный объект (Создать связь) |
✅ Да | ✅ Да (требует исходный файл) | ✅ Да | ✅ Высокое | ✅ Да |
| Экспорт Excel в PDF → Вставка PDF в Word | ❌ Нет | ❌ Нет | ❌ Нет | ✅ Высокое | ✅ Да |
2. Пошаговая инструкция: как вставить Excel в Word со связью (динамическое обновление)
Этот метод подходит, если вам нужно, чтобы таблица в Word автоматически обновлялась при изменении данных в Excel. Например, для ежемесячных отчётов, где исходные данные хранятся в отдельном файле.
Алгоритм работает в Office 2010–2026 (включая Microsoft 365). Важно: исходный файл Excel должен оставаться на том же месте — при перемещении связь разорвётся.
Откройте оба файла (Excel и Word)
Сохраните файл Excel в окончательной папке (не перемещайте его позже)
Выделите диапазон ячеек в Excel (не весь лист!)
Убедитесь, что в Word курсор стоит в нужном месте-->
В Excel выделите диапазон ячеек, который нужно вставить. Если требуется весь лист, нажмите
Ctrl+A(но это увеличит размер файла Word).Скопируйте данные:
Главная → Копировать(илиCtrl+C).Перейдите в Word и поставьте курсор в место вставки.
Нажмите
Главная → Вставить → Специальная вставка(или комбинациюCtrl+Alt+V).В открывшемся окне выберите:
Формат:Лист Microsoft Excel (Объект)
Действие:Создать связь(поставьте галочку!).
Нажмите
OK.
После вставки таблица будет отображаться как объект Excel. Чтобы обновить данные:
- Кликните правой кнопкой по таблице.
- Выберите
Объект Лист → Связи(илиОбновить данныев новых версиях). - Нажмите
Обновить сейчас.
⚠️ Внимание: В Office 2019 и новее при первом обновлении связи может появиться предупреждение безопасности:"Автоматическое обновление связей отключено". Чтобы исправить это, перейдите вФайл → Параметры → Центр управления безопасностью → Параметры центра управления безопасностью → Внешнее содержимое → Включить автоматическое обновление для всех документов.
3. Вставка Excel как редактируемого объекта (без привязки)
Если вам не нужно автоматическое обновление, но требуется возможность редактировать таблицу прямо в Word (например, корректировать формулы или форматирование), используйте этот метод. Таблица станет частью документа, но сохранит функциональность Excel.
Преимущество способа: файл Word становится самостоятельным — не требуется хранить исходный .xlsx. Недостаток: изменения в оригинальном Excel не отразятся в Word.
В Excel выделите нужный диапазон (или весь лист) и скопируйте (
Ctrl+C).В Word нажмите
Главная → Вставить → Специальная вставка.Выберите формат
Лист Microsoft Excel (Объект), но не ставьте галочкуСоздать связь!Нажмите
OK. Таблица вставится как редактируемый объект.
Чтобы отредактировать таблицу:
- Дважды кликните по ней — откроется мини-редактор Excel.
- Измените данные или формулы (например,
=СУММ(A1:A10)). - Кликните за пределами таблицы, чтобы сохранить изменения.
Как изменить размер вставленной таблицы Excel в Word?
Если таблица не помещается на странице, кликните по её углу (появится рамка с маркерами) и потяните за угловые точки. Чтобы сохранить пропорции, зажмите Shift при изменении размера. Для точной настройки перейдите в Формат → Размер (появится при выделении таблицы).
4. Вставка Excel как картинки (для фиксированных отчётов)
Если вам нужно, чтобы таблица выглядела идентично оригиналу (с сохранением шрифтов, цветов и границ), но при этом не требовала обновлений, лучший вариант — вставить её как рисунок. Это актуально для:
- 📊 Отчётов, которые будут распечатаны или отправлены в PDF.
- 📱 Документов, которые будут открываться на устройствах без Excel (например, на телефоне).
- 🔒 Защиты данных от изменений (картинку нельзя редактировать).
Есть 2 способа вставить Excel как изображение:
Способ 1: Копирование как рисунок (быстро)
- В Excel выделите диапазон и нажмите
Главная → Копировать → Копировать как рисунок. - В окне выберите:
Как на экране(для точного отображения)
или
Как при печати(для чёрно-белых документов). - Вставьте в Word (
Ctrl+V).
Способ 2: Сохранение как PDF → Вставка из PDF (высокое качество)
- В Excel выделите область и сохраните как PDF (
Файл → Экспорт → Создать PDF/XPS). - Откройте созданный PDF в Adobe Acrobat или браузере.
- Скопируйте таблицу как изображение (
Правка → Копировать изображениеилиPrtScn). - Вставьте в Word и обрежьте лишние поля (
Формат → Обрезка).
⚠️ Внимание: При вставке больших таблиц (более 50 строк) как картинку может ухудшиться читаемость текста. В этом случае перед копированием в Excel уменьшите масштаб до70–80%(Вид → Масштаб), затем повторите процедуру.
5. Проблемы и решения при вставке Excel в Word
Даже при точном следовании инструкциям могут возникать ошибки. Мы собрали TOP-5 проблем и способы их решения:
| Проблема | Причина | Решение |
|---|---|---|
| Таблица в Word отображается пустой (серый фон) | Не установлен Excel на компьютере или повреждён объект OLE | Установите Excel или вставьте таблицу как картинку. Альтернатива: сохраните Excel как PDF и вставьте страницу |
| При двойном клике открывается пустое окно | Повреждение связи или конфликт версий Office | Удалите объект и вставьте заново. Если не помогает, обновите Office до последней версии |
Формулы отображаются как текст ({=СУММ(A1:B1)}) |
Вставка выполнена как "Текст" вместо "Объект Excel" | Повторите вставку через Специальная вставка → Лист Microsoft Excel (Объект) |
| Таблица разбивается на несколько страниц | Слишком большой диапазон или неправильные настройки разрыва страниц | Уменьшите масштаб таблицы в Word (Формат → Размер) или разбейте исходные данные в Excel на несколько диапазонов |
При обновлении связи появляется ошибка "Файл не найден" |
Исходный файл Excel перемещён или переименован | Кликните правой кнопкой по таблице → Связи → Изменить источник и укажите новый путь |
Если ни один из методов не работает, попробуйте альтернативный способ:
- Сохраните лист Excel как веб-страницу (
Файл → Сохранить как → Веб-страница (*.html)). - Откройте сохранённый .html в браузере, скопируйте таблицу и вставьте в Word.
6. Оптимизация вставленной таблицы для печати
Частая проблема при вставке Excel в Word — некорректное отображение на печати: обрезанные края, мелкий шрифт или смещённые границы. Чтобы избежать этого:
- 📏 Настройте поля: Перейдите в
Макет → Поля → Узкие(илиПользовательские поляс отступами не менее 1 см). - 🔍 Масштабируйте таблицу: Кликните по вставленному объекту →
Формат → Размери установите ширину не более16 см(для А4). - 🖨️ Проверьте предварительный просмотр:
Файл → Печать(в Word) до финальной распечатки. - 🎨 Используйте монохромный стиль: Если печать чёрно-белая, в Excel примените стиль
Главная → Стили → Хорошо (для данных).
Для сложных таблиц (с объединёнными ячейками или многоуровневыми заголовками) рекомендуем:
- В Excel зафиксируйте области печати:
Разметка страницы → Область печати → Задать. - Экспортируйте в PDF (
Файл → Экспорт → PDF) и вставьте PDF в Word как объект.
7. Альтернативные инструменты для вставки Excel в Word
Если стандартные методы не подходят (например, из-за ограничений корпоративной версии Office), рассмотрите специализированные инструменты:
- 📑 ExcelToWord (надстройка): Платное решение для автоматической вставки диапазонов с сохранением форматирования. Поддерживает
VBA-макросы. - 🌐 Online-конвертеры: Сервисы вроде CloudConvert или Zamzar позволяют конвертировать
.xlsxв.docxс таблицами. - 🤖 Power Automate (Microsoft): Автоматизирует перенос данных из Excel в Word по расписанию (требует навыков работы с потоками).
- 📊 Google Таблицы + Google Docs: Если используете Google Workspace, вставьте таблицу через
Вставка → Таблица → Из Google Таблиц(обновляется в реальном времени).
Для продвинутых пользователей: если вам нужно вставлять данные из нескольких файлов Excel в один документ Word, используйте VBA-макрос:
Sub InsertExcelToWord()
Dim wdApp As Object, wdDoc As Object
Dim xlApp As Object, xlBook As Object
Set wdApp = CreateObject("Word.Application")
Set wdDoc = wdApp.Documents.Add
Set xlApp = CreateObject("Excel.Application")
Set xlBook = xlApp.Workbooks.Open("C:\Path\To\Your\File.xlsx")
' Копируем диапазон A1:D10
xlBook.Sheets(1).Range("A1:D10").Copy
' Вставляем в Word со связью
wdDoc.Range.PasteSpecial Link:=True, DataType:=0 ' 0 = Лист Excel
wdDoc.SaveAs "C:\Output\Document.docx"
wdApp.Quit
xlApp.Quit
End Sub
⚠️ Внимание: Макросы работают только при включённой поддержке VBA (в Office 2026 может потребоваться ручное разрешение в Файл → Параметры → Центр управления безопасностью).
FAQ: Частые вопросы по вставке Excel в Word
Можно ли вставить в Word только часть листа Excel (например, диапазон A1:G20)?
Да, для этого выделите нужный диапазон в Excel перед копированием. При вставке через Специальная вставка → Лист Microsoft Excel (Объект) в Word попадёт только выделенная область. Если вы скопируете весь лист (Ctrl+A), в документ вставится вся таблица, даже если видно только часть.
Почему после вставки Excel в Word исчезают формулы?
Это происходит, если вы выбрали формат вставки Текст или Таблица Word вместо Лист Microsoft Excel (Объект). Формулы сохранятся только при вставке как объект Excel. Чтобы вернуть формулы:
- Удалите вставленную таблицу.
- Повторите вставку через
Специальная вставка, выбрав правильный формат.
Как обновить данные в Word, если исходный файл Excel изменился?
Если вы вставляли таблицу со связью, кликните по ней правой кнопкой и выберите Обновить данные (или Связи → Обновить сейчас). Для автоматического обновления при открытии документа:
- Перейдите в
Файл → Параметры → Дополнительно. - В разделе
Общиепоставьте галочкуОбновлять автоматические связи при открытии.
Если связь разорвана, кликните Связи → Изменить источник и укажите новый путь к файлу.
Можно ли вставить в Word таблицу Excel с сохранением условного форматирования?
Да, но только если вставлять как Лист Microsoft Excel (Объект) без связи. Условное форматирование (цветовые шкалы, значки) поддерживается, но:
- При вставке со связью форматирование может сброситься при обновлении.
- В старых версиях Word (2010 и ранее) некоторые стили условного форматирования отображаются некорректно.
Рекомендуем перед вставкой в Excel применить Главная → Формат как таблицу — это улучшит совместимость.
Как вставить в Word сводную таблицу из Excel без потери интерактивности?
Сводные таблицы (PivotTable) можно вставить в Word с сохранением фильтров и группировок, но только как объект Excel:
- В Excel выделите сводную таблицу (кликните по ней → появится вкладка
Анализ). - Скопируйте (
Ctrl+C). - В Word вставьте через
Специальная вставка → Лист Microsoft Excel (Объект).
После вставки вы сможете:
- Раскрывать/сворачивать группы двойным кликом.
- Менять фильтры (если вставлено со связью).
Ограничение: в Word нельзя добавить новые поля в сводную таблицу — только редактировать существующие.